## Runbook: dependency pinning policy

All services under the Harrowgate umbrella pin direct dependencies to exact versions; transitive versions are locked via the generated lockfile and committed. Upgrades happen on the first Tuesday of each month through the Bramblebot PR flow — never manually edit the lockfile. If a security patch lands mid-cycle, pin it explicitly and note it in the changelog. Emergency unpins require two reviewer approvals. The pinning checker runs in CI with the following configuration values.

config for tawif-bagef:
[sorwyn]
team = sorys
access_code = ac_9ba40c
host = sorwyn.ordingrid.local
port = 5000
owner = aldok.quenion
peer = belath.paliqcloud.local

# Settings: event schema registry
#
# Reviewer notes: the Pellgrove registry validates every event
# payload against a versioned schema before it reaches the bus.
# Unknown schema versions are rejected, not coerced — this is
# intentional; see RFC-22. Compatibility mode is BACKWARD only.
# Cache TTL is 60s; do not raise it without benchmarking the
# validator path first. Registry metadata (schemas, versions,
# compat rules) lives in its own database, separate from the
# event store. The registry connects using the string below.

primary connection of badup-fahop = postgresql://praael_svc:IJ@db-b405.halixstack.internal:5432/tamael

Handover note — Crumbwheel order cutoffs.

Welcome aboard. The bakery cutoff rule in Crumbwheel closes same-day orders at 14:00 local to each storefront, not UTC — this has bitten us twice. Holiday overrides live in the calendar service and take precedence silently, so always check there first when a cutoff looks wrong. To unlock the calendar service's admin console after a restart, enter the recovery passphrase below.

vault phrase of bagap-bahaf = silion-pelox-sorox-casdor-quenwyn-fraax-eliox-praael-kelion-quenvan-kasox-rusael-norius-belvan